About John Cyrus
John Cyrus is a scholar working on Surgery, Epidemiology, General Health Professions,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Clinical Psychology, having authored 77 papers that have together received 846 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Shoulder Injury and Treatment (4 papers), Cervical Cancer and HPV Research (3 papers), Mechanical Circulatory Support Devices (3 papers), Health Sciences Research and Education (3 papers), Innovations in Medical Education (3 papers), Hip disorders and treatments (2 papers), Substance Abuse Treatment and Outcomes (2 papers) and Mobile Health and mHealth Applications (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Family Practice (24 citations), Medical Terminology (2 citations), Applied Psychology (18 citations), Epidemiology (114 citations) and Radiological and Ultrasound Technology (17 citations). John Cyrus has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Netherlands and United Arab Emirates. Frequent co-authors include Georges Adunlin, Michael S. Ryan, Lindsay M. Sabik, Matthew Asare, Deborah DiazGranados, Teresa Day, Camille J. Hochheimer, Roy T. Sabo, Karen E. Dyer and Steven H. Woolf. Their work appears in journals such as Medical Reference Services Quarterly, The Journal of Arthroplasty, Western Journal of Emergency Medicine, Journal of Women s Health and Orthopaedic Journal of Sports Medicine.
